My child uses their phone / wearable device as an adjustment to access and participate in the curriculum. Can they still use it? 

Yes, exemptions will be made available for students who require access to their mobile phone or wearable device for learning, medical, disability and/or wellbeing reasons. 

This may include scenarios where:

  • the mobile phone or wearable device is used as an agreed reasonable adjustment for a student with disability or learning difficulties
  • the mobile phone or wearable device is used by the student as an augmentative or alternative communication system or as an aide to access and participate in the environment e.g. navigation or object/people identification applications
  • the mobile phone or wearable device is used as an agreed adjustment for a student with English as an additional language or dialect
  • students in Years 11 and 12 are applying for Access Arrangements and Reasonable Adjustments (AARA) for assistive technology.
